East European University: Overview

One of the most popular destinations for international students, particularly those pursuing an MBBS degree, is East European University (EEU), which is situated in Tbilisi, Georgia. Founded with a vision to offer top-quality education that meets international standards, EEU is recognized for its student-friendly environment, modern infrastructure, and a curriculum tailored to global medical trends.

Affiliation and Recognition

  • National Center for Educational Quality Enhancement (NCEQE), Georgia
  • World Health Organization (WHO)
  • National Medical Commission (NMC), India
  • World Directory of Medical Schools (WDOMS)

Eligibility Standard

  • Minimum 50% marks in PCB (Higher Secondary)
  • NEET qualification (for Indian students)
  • Age: Must be 17 years or older at the time of admission

Courses & Syllabus

  • Pre-clinical subjects: Anatomy, Physiology, Biochemistry
  • Para-clinical subjects: Pathology, Microbiology, Pharmacology
  • Clinical subjects: Medicine, Surgery, Obstetrics, Pediatrics, Psychiatry, etc.
  • Internship and clinical rotations in affiliated hospitals

The MBBS program occurs at East European University

The MBBS program at EEU is based on a modern, European-style curriculum and includes Pre-clinical subjects: Anatomy, Physiology, Biochemistry, Para-clinical subjects: Pathology, Microbiology, Pharmacology, Clinical subjects: Medicine, Surgery, Obstetrics, Pediatrics, Psychiatry, etc., Internship and clinical rotations in affiliated hospitals.

Hostel & Accommodation

  • Separate hostels for boys and girls
  • Fully furnished rooms with Wi-Fi
  • Indian food served in hostel canteens
  • 24/7 security, laundry, kitchen & heating facilities
  • Cost: USD 2,000 – 2,500 annually
